    Freaky Tales:  Green Light in the Dark

    There’s a pulse beneath the pavement in Freaky Tales, a throb of resistance and rage, of grief and neon hope. Directed by Anna Boden and Ryan Fleck, this horror-tinged anthology unfolds across four interwoven tales set in 1987 Oakland, each steeped in real locations and historical echoes.     Sundance 2025: Sunfish and Other Stories on Green Lake: A Refreshing Slice-of-Life Journey

    Movie Info: An anthology following the residents of a small town and the lake that binds them together. Review: **Sunfish and Other Stories on Green Lake **, directed by Sierra Falconer, is a charming and refreshing slice-of-life drama that premiered at the 2025 Sundance Film Festival.
